I've got a transition conflict question. I've got R13 this month. My last day of a group of 5 R13's is on NOV 29. If I bid an R13 that has Dec 1-5 on R13, will this create a conflict? Does the fact that the R13 ends at 0300 on NOV 30 count to make a conflict, or will the fact that there's more than a 30 hour break between NOV 30 at 0300 and DEC 1 at 1300 negate the conflict.

The 30th is not a day off. You are working five rsv periods over six days. A block of days starting on the first would create a conflict yes. The contract protects you here not 117. Under 117 you could legally work 12 days in a row because of the 30hr break. The contract says you work no more than six.
